Originally posted by Nite69:
yea you can get it to run on 20 series and 30 series with a edited file but at the same time it won't work well because they don't have the optical flow accelerator like the 40 series does
Just for clarification, the 20 and 30 series both have optical flow accelerators but the 40 series has an upgraded version
